 <description>&lt;p&gt;After reading about the crisis Manatee County is facing in regards to teen pregnancy one thing was evident; the county&#039;s approach to abstinence only sexual education is failing miserably. Here are the sobering facts:&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;Manatee County has one of the highest teen pregnancy rates in the state.&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;Out of 67 counties, Manatee is the 17th highest; and, in births to teens 10 to 14 years of age, Manatee has the 13th highest rate.&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;In 2006, one-third of 2,196 ninth-graders surveyed admitted that they had sexual intercourse. This was a 3 percent increase over the 2004 results.&lt;/p&gt;
